Substance3D - Stager versions 3.0.3 and earlier are affected by a Write-what-where Condition vulnerability that could allow an attacker to execute arbitrary code in the context of the current user. This vulnerability allows an attacker to write a controlled value to an arbitrary memory location, potentially leading to code execution. Exploitation of this issue requires user interaction in that a victim must open a malicious file.

The severity of CVE-2024-45142 is high due to its potential to allow arbitrary code execution.
To fix CVE-2024-45142, update Adobe Substance 3D Stager to version 3.0.4 or later.
CVE-2024-45142 affects versions 3.0.3 and earlier of Adobe Substance 3D Stager on supported operating systems.
CVE-2024-45142 is a Write-what-where Condition vulnerability.
CVE-2024-45142 requires local access to exploit the vulnerability.
